Subcool's Krack Strain Overview
Subcool's Krack is a hybrid cannabis strain developed by legendary breeder Subcool (also known as MzJill) of TGA Genetics. The strain was created through a selective breeding process that combined genetics from multiple established varieties to produce a balanced hybrid with distinctive characteristics. Subcool, known for his work with strains like Jack the Ripper and Querkle, developed this strain as part of his extensive breeding program focused on creating unique flavor profiles and reliable effects.
The strain typically produces medium-sized plants with dense, resinous buds that exhibit a complex coloration ranging from deep green to purple hues, often accented with vibrant orange pistils. The flowers are known for their heavy trichome coverage, giving them a frosty appearance. Subcool's Krack is recognized for its balanced genetic expression, offering a combination of both indica and sativa traits that has made it popular among cultivators seeking versatile genetics.
Notable features include its complex aroma profile and the breeder's reputation for quality genetics. As with many strains from TGA Genetics, Subcool's Krack was developed with attention to both cultivation characteristics and consumer experience. The strain has maintained a following among cannabis enthusiasts, particularly those familiar with Subcool's breeding work, though it is considered less common than some of his more widely distributed creations.

Subcool's Krack Strain Growing Information
Subcool's Krack is considered a moderate difficulty strain to cultivate, suitable for growers with some experience. The plants typically flower in 8-10 weeks indoors and are ready for harvest by mid to late October when grown outdoors. Indoor yields are moderate to high, with proper cultivation techniques producing approximately 400-500 grams per square meter. Outdoor plants can yield 500-600 grams per plant in optimal conditions.
The strain adapts well to both indoor and outdoor growing environments, though it prefers a Mediterranean-like climate with consistent temperatures. Plants tend to reach a medium height, making them manageable for indoor cultivation with proper training techniques. Special considerations include maintaining good air circulation to prevent mold in dense buds and providing adequate nutrient support during the flowering phase. The strain responds well to training methods like topping and low-stress training to maximize yield.
